Monster Sound System?
Has anyone ever put a MONSTER sound system into an XJ? By "monster" I
mean like amp under the back seat with new speakers where ever they can fit. Probably replace exhisting speakers with better performing ones. I was even thinking about mounting a sub woofer inside the spare tire. I love the stock amfm/cd player and would like to keep it. Thoughts? Thanks! |
